Output 3c81f56f6bcc61a69c95319c962999efe8389191f1d927d87214dd39cfb86ea7:1

value
5753476
script pubkey
OP_0 OP_PUSHBYTES_20 7d75a36758d612baba6b2bf05af04be6537f0efc
address
bc1q0466xe6c6cft4wnt90c94uztuefh7rhux7lyzv
transaction
3c81f56f6bcc61a69c95319c962999efe8389191f1d927d87214dd39cfb86ea7
confirmations
52874
spent
true